Why Hair Towel Choice Matters More Than You Think
Most people underestimate the impact of a simple towel on hair health. Standard cotton bath towels have coarse fibers that create friction when you rub or twist your hair. This friction lifts the hair cuticle, leading to frizz, tangles, and even breakage over time. If you dry your hair vigorously with a terry cloth towel, you are essentially roughing up the outermost layer of each strand, which can make hair look dull and feel rough.
Microfiber towels have become a popular alternative because they are smoother and more absorbent, reducing friction and drying time. However, not all microfiber is created equal — some are made with synthetic blends that can still snag on fine or curly hair.
